Q: Is 444,514,273 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 444,514,273 is a composite number.

Why is 444,514,273 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 444,514,273 can be evenly divided by 1 7 107 541 749 1,097 3,787 7,679 57,887 117,379 405,209 593,477 821,653 4,154,339 63,502,039 and 444,514,273, with no remainder.

Since 444,514,273 cannot be divided by just 1 and 444,514,273, it is a composite number.
